PR 197379: Add an option to run `syslogd' in the foreground

+.It Fl F
+Run
+.Nm
+in the foreground, rather than going into daemon mode. This is useful if
+some other process uses
+.Xr fork 2
+and
+.Xr exec 3
+to run
+.Nm ,
+and wants to monitor when and how it exits.
